Downstate Correctional Facility inmate charged with forcible touching

Fishkill, New York – On April 14, 2015, New York State Police Bureau of Criminal Investigation charged 44-year-old Jonny Anjudar, of Downstate Correctional Facility, with Forcible Touching, a Class A Misdemeanor.

On February 17, 2015, Troopers were contacted by the New York State Department of Corrections and Community Services at Downstate Correctional Facility to investigate the report of a sexual offense. Pursuant to an investigation conducted by New York State DOCCS and Investigators from the Wappinger barracks, it was discovered that a male inmate forcibly touched a female Downstate Correctional employee.

A warrant was issued by the Town of Fishkill Court ordering Anjudar’s arrest. On April 14, 2015, Anjudar was arrested and remanded back the custody of NYS DOCCS.
